If you are a #MastoAdmin #FediAdmin, you may want to purge a.gup.pe from your server.

In Mastodon, go into admin > Moderation > Federation > Add new domain block. Create one for the domain name "gup.pe" (subdomains are included) with "suspend" severity. Once added, go into the details for the newly added block and you'll find the "Purge" button right at the bottom of the page.

⚠️ ⚠️ Once the domain is purged, the list of severed follows will no longer be available to local users. ⚠️ ⚠️

Question for Mastodon Admins/moderators:
If someone has unconventionally reported a large number of accounts, by simply providing their Mastodon handles via a textual DM, rather than using the usual report function within the web interface, and I search these remote accounts from the accounts page of the moderation section, every search comes up with "nothing here". I then cannot take any further action on the search, as my instance is not seeing any accounts to take action on. Is there something else I can/should be doing to be able to suspend these accounts?
